We spent one night at the Inn on the Square and it was great. The room was huge and the rate ($65) was very good. Our room had two double beds and they were very comfortable. Everything was very clean and comfortable. There is a "library" that has a small tv and a few chairs. We spent a lot of time in that room and it was just fine. There is an antique store, a clothing store, and a little gift store (mostly candles) on site. The best part of the stay was the breakfast. It is made by the owner and it was absolutely delicious! We loved the simple touches she added to make it very homey. When we arrived downstairs for breakfast, there was orange juice, honeydew melon, and nut bread waiting for us. The breakfast consisted of scrambled eggs with ham and cheese mixed in, delicious potatoes, and raisin bread. It was all wonderful. The Inn also hosts a brunch on Sundays for the public.
